一种吸嘴检测计数方法、系统、设备和存储介质技术方案

技术编号:30554484 阅读:18 留言:0更新日期:2021-10-30 13:35
本发明专利技术实施例公开了吸嘴检测计数方法,基于待测吸嘴的基本参数和吸力指标,采用当前节点的私钥进行加密,结合待测吸嘴的明文吸嘴型号得到待上传检测数据;将待上传检测数据上传到区块链中;接收区块链的共识机制验证结果,若结果为通过则当前节点的计数值加一;获取区块链中与待测吸嘴的型号相同的检测数据,当前节点的计数值减一;根据上传节点的公钥对检测数据进行解密,得到检测数据集;根据使用记录和生产日期相似度要求,选出检测数据集的数据作为历史检测数据集;根据吸力指标和历史检测数据集获得待测吸嘴的检测结果。本发明专利技术实施例提供了吸嘴检测计数系统、设备和介质,在有效提高吸嘴检测效率的同时,兼顾检测的精度。兼顾检测的精度。兼顾检测的精度。

【技术实现步骤摘要】
一种吸嘴检测计数方法、系统、设备和存储介质


[0001]本专利技术涉及贴片机吸嘴检测的
,尤其涉及一种吸嘴检测计数方法、系统、设备和存储介质。

技术介绍

[0002]在芯片的生产过程中,贴片生产线的贴片机通过吸嘴将元器件吸取后再贴装到印刷线路板上,吸嘴的工作状态直接影响到贴装质量。由于现在常用吸嘴前端较小,一般只有0.6*0.6mm以内,并且吸嘴是直接接触元器件的部件,在与元器件接触的过程中容易出现磨损,导致吸嘴的吸力受到影响。使用问题吸嘴进行生产可能会造成抛料、飞料等,直接影响贴装质量,因此对贴片机吸嘴的检查尤为关键。
[0003]专利技术人在实施本专利技术的过程中发现,由于吸嘴前端较小,现有的吸嘴检测方法中,为得到较为可靠的检测结果,一般采用的方式包括:(1)提高检测设备的精度,但设备更换以及检测成本较高;(2)对吸嘴进行多次检测,从而通过对多组数据进行分析以降低检测误差,但将对吸嘴产生更多不必要的磨损,并且延长检测所需的时间,检测效率低下。

技术实现思路

[0004]本专利技术的目的在于提供一种吸嘴检测计数方法、系统、设备和存储介质,能够在有效提高吸嘴检测效率的同时,兼顾检测的精度,实现快速且精确的吸嘴检测。
[0005]本专利技术第一实施例提供了一种吸嘴检测计数方法,包括步骤:
[0006]S1、获取待测吸嘴的基本参数;所述待测吸嘴的基本参数包括吸嘴型号、使用记录和生产日期;
[0007]S2、抽取所述待测吸嘴中的气体,使所述待测吸嘴处于吸取状态;获取处于吸取状态下的所述待测吸嘴的吸力指标;
[0008]S3、基于所述待测吸嘴的基本参数和所述吸力指标,采用当前节点的私钥进行加密,并结合所述待测吸嘴的明文吸嘴型号得到待上传检测数据;将所述待上传检测数据上传到区块链中;
[0009]S4、接收所述区块链对所述待上传检测数据的共识机制验证结果,若所述验证结果为通过,则所述当前节点的计数值加一;
[0010]S5、从所述区块链中获取与所述待测吸嘴的型号相同的多个检测数据,同时所述当前节点的计数值减一;每个所述检测数据包括明文吸嘴型号以及加密文本,所述加密文本为所述检测数据的上传节点基于受测吸嘴的基本参数和检测结果,采用所述上传节点的私钥进行加密得到的密文信息;
[0011]S6、根据预先获取的每个所述上传节点的公钥对所述多个检测数据进行解密,得到检测数据集;根据预设的使用记录相似度要求和生产日期相似度要求,从所述检测数据集中筛选出满足要求的所述检测数据,得到历史检测数据集;
[0012]S7、根据所述吸力指标和所述历史检测数据集中的检测数据,获得所述待测吸嘴
的检测结果。
[0013]作为上述方案的改进,所述共识机制验证包括:
[0014]所述区块链中的任一节点,根据所述当前节点的公钥和所述待上传检测数据,获得加密前的吸嘴型号;若所述加密前的吸嘴型号与所述明文吸嘴型号一致,则在所述区块链中发出验证通过信号;若不一致,则发出验证失败信号;
[0015]若所述区块链中超过半数的节点发出验证通过信号,则所述验证结果为通过;若超过半数的节点发出验证失败信号,则删除所述待上传检测数据。
[0016]作为上述方案的改进,步骤S5包括:
[0017]获取所述当前节点的计数值;所述区块链中任一节点的计数值预设为N,N为正整数;
[0018]若所述当前节点的计数值大于零,则从所述区块链中获取与所述待测吸嘴的型号相同的多个检测数据,同时所述当前节点的计数值减一;
[0019]若所述当前节点的计数值小于或等于零,则反馈检测数据获取失败信息。
[0020]作为上述方案的改进,所述吸力指标为所述待测吸嘴的真空度和吸力中的至少一项;所述检测数据包括真空度和吸力中的至少一项;使用记录包括吸嘴的使用次数、吸嘴的吸取对象和吸嘴的保养记录。
[0021]作为上述方案的改进,所述预设的使用记录相似度要求包括以下至少一项:
[0022]所述检测数据中的使用次数与所述待测吸嘴的使用次数相差不超过第一阈值;
[0023]所述检测数据中的吸取对象与所述待测吸嘴的吸取对象表面材料相同;
[0024]所述检测数据中的保养记录与所述待测吸嘴的保养记录次数相差不超过第二阈值。
[0025]作为上述方案的改进,所述生产日期相似度要求包括:所述检测数据中的生产日期与所述待测吸嘴的生产日期相差不超过第三阈值。
[0026]作为上述方案的改进,步骤S7包括:
[0027]根据所述吸力指标和所述历史检测数据集中的检测数据进行加权平均,获得所述待测吸嘴的检测结果;或,
[0028]将所述吸力指标和所述历史检测数据集中的检测数据输入预先训练的神经网络模型,获得所述待测吸嘴的检测结果。
[0029]本专利技术第二实施例还提供了一种吸嘴检测计数系统,包括接入到同一区块链网络中的多个节点;每个所述节点用于执行如下步骤:
[0030]S1、获取待测吸嘴的基本参数;所述待测吸嘴的基本参数包括吸嘴型号、使用记录和生产日期;
[0031]S2、抽取所述待测吸嘴中的气体,使所述待测吸嘴处于吸取状态;获取处于吸取状态下的所述待测吸嘴的吸力指标;
[0032]S3、基于所述待测吸嘴的基本参数和所述吸力指标,采用当前节点的私钥进行加密,并结合所述待测吸嘴的明文吸嘴型号得到待上传检测数据;将所述待上传检测数据上传到区块链中;
[0033]S4、接收所述区块链对所述待上传检测数据的共识机制验证结果,若所述验证结果为通过,则所述当前节点的计数值加一;
[0034]S5、从所述区块链中获取与所述待测吸嘴的型号相同的多个检测数据,同时所述当前节点的计数值减一;每个所述检测数据包括明文吸嘴型号以及加密文本,所述加密文本为所述检测数据的上传节点基于受测吸嘴的基本参数和检测结果,采用所述上传节点的私钥进行加密得到的密文信息;
[0035]S6、根据预先获取的每个所述上传节点的公钥对所述多个检测数据进行解密,得到检测数据集;根据预设的使用记录相似度要求和生产日期相似度要求,从所述检测数据集中筛选出满足要求的所述检测数据,得到历史检测数据集;
[0036]S7、根据所述吸力指标和所述历史检测数据集中的检测数据,获得所述待测吸嘴的检测结果。
[0037]本专利技术第三实施例还提供了一种吸嘴检测计数设备,包括吸力检测部、处理器、存储器以及存储在所述存储器中且被配置为由所述处理器执行的计算机程序;
[0038]所述吸力检测部用于检测待测吸嘴的吸力指标;
[0039]所述处理器执行所述计算机程序时配合所述吸力检测部以实现如上任意一项所述的吸嘴检测计数方法。
[0040]本专利技术第四实施例还提供了一种计算机可读存储介质,所述计算机可读存储介质包括存储的计算机程序;其中,在所述计算机程序运行时控制所述计算机可读存储介质所在设备实现如上任意一项所述的吸嘴检测计数方法。
[本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种吸嘴检测计数方法,其特征在于,包括步骤:S1、获取待测吸嘴的基本参数;所述待测吸嘴的基本参数包括吸嘴型号、使用记录和生产日期;S2、抽取所述待测吸嘴中的气体,使所述待测吸嘴处于吸取状态;获取处于吸取状态下的所述待测吸嘴的吸力指标;S3、基于所述待测吸嘴的基本参数和所述吸力指标,采用当前节点的私钥进行加密,并结合所述待测吸嘴的明文吸嘴型号得到待上传检测数据;将所述待上传检测数据上传到区块链中;S4、接收所述区块链对所述待上传检测数据的共识机制验证结果,若所述验证结果为通过,则所述当前节点的计数值加一;S5、从所述区块链中获取与所述待测吸嘴的型号相同的多个检测数据,同时所述当前节点的计数值减一;每个所述检测数据包括明文吸嘴型号以及加密文本,所述加密文本为所述检测数据的上传节点基于受测吸嘴的基本参数和检测结果,采用所述上传节点的私钥进行加密得到的密文信息;S6、根据预先获取的每个所述上传节点的公钥对所述多个检测数据进行解密,得到检测数据集;根据预设的使用记录相似度要求和生产日期相似度要求,从所述检测数据集中筛选出满足要求的所述检测数据,得到历史检测数据集;S7、根据所述吸力指标和所述历史检测数据集中的检测数据,获得所述待测吸嘴的检测结果。2.如权利要求1所述的吸嘴检测计数方法,其特征在于,所述共识机制验证包括:所述区块链中的任一节点,根据所述当前节点的公钥和所述待上传检测数据,获得加密前的吸嘴型号;若所述加密前的吸嘴型号与所述明文吸嘴型号一致,则在所述区块链中发出验证通过信号;若不一致,则发出验证失败信号;若所述区块链中超过半数的节点发出验证通过信号,则所述验证结果为通过;若超过半数的节点发出验证失败信号,则删除所述待上传检测数据。3.如权利要求1所述的吸嘴检测计数方法,其特征在于,步骤S5包括:获取所述当前节点的计数值;所述区块链中任一节点的计数值预设为N,N为正整数;若所述当前节点的计数值大于零,则从所述区块链中获取与所述待测吸嘴的型号相同的多个检测数据,同时所述当前节点的计数值减一;若所述当前节点的计数值小于或等于零,则反馈检测数据获取失败信息。4.如权利要求1所述的吸嘴检测计数方法,其特征在于,所述吸力指标为所述待测吸嘴的真空度和吸力中的至少一项;所述检测数据包括真空度和吸力中的至少一项;使用记录包括吸嘴的使用次数、吸嘴的吸取对象和吸嘴的保养记录。5.如权利要求4所述的吸嘴检测计数方法,其特征在于,所述预设的使用记录相似度要求包括以下至少一项:所述检测数据中的使用次数与所述待测吸嘴的使用次数相差不超过第一阈值;所...

【专利技术属性】
技术研发人员:冯韵涵
申请(专利权)人:九江嘉远科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1